Add 5/49 and 21/9
1st number: 5/49, 2nd number: 2 3/9
5/49 + 21/9 is 358/147.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 49 and 9 is 441
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 441 - For the 1st fraction, since 49 × 9 = 441,
5/49 = 5 × 9/49 × 9 = 45/441 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 9 × 49 = 441,
21/9 = 21 × 49/9 × 49 = 1029/441 - Add the two like fractions:
45/441 + 1029/441 = 45 + 1029/441 = 1074/441 - 1074/441 simplified gives 358/147
- So, 5/49 + 21/9 = 358/147
